A highly ranked and well-respected Corporate Real Estate practice is seeking an Associate to join its growing London team. The practice advises leading private equity funds, institutional investors, investment managers, developers and real estate platforms on sophisticated and high-value transactions across the full real‑estate asset spectrum. The team sits at the intersection of real estate, private equity and corporate M&A, acting on complex cross‑border and UK transactions. Work includes fund‑driven real estate acquisitions and exits, joint venture structuring, platform investments, recapitalisations, and portfolio‑level M&A involving logistics, residential, hospitality, retail parks, office and alternative real‑asset classes.

What to expect:

  • Formation and structuring of real estate joint ventures between private equity sponsors, institutional investors, developers and operators.
  • Real estate private equity platform investments, including the acquisition and disposal of large‑scale logistics, residential and mixed‑use portfolios.
  • Cross‑border acquisitions and disposals of real estate assets, holding companies and fund‑owned corporate structures.
  • Cornerstone investments by global and pan‑European real estate funds into sector‑specific vehicles (e.g., retail parks, industrial outdoor storage, multifamily).
  • Equity recapitalisations of real estate development companies and operating platforms.
  • Minority and majority stake acquisitions in real estate investment managers, developers and credit platforms.

Responsibilities:

  • Draft, negotiate and review a wide range of documents, including SPA/asset purchase agreements, joint venture/shareholder agreements, fund/co‑investment documentation, development agreements and ancillary corporate documents.
  • Assist on M&A‑style real estate transactions, including acquisitions and disposals of property‑owning companies and real estate operating platforms.
  • Support clients on complex joint ventures and co‑investment structures, including governance arrangements and ongoing investment management.
  • Work closely with senior lawyers and partners on transaction strategy, negotiation and execution.

Requirements:

  • England & Wales qualified solicitor with 2‑6 years of experience within a US, Magic/Silver Circle firm in London.
  • Strong experience in at least one of the following: corporate real estate, real estate private equity, real assets M&A, joint ventures, fund/RE investment structures.
  • Familiarity with corporate and real estate transaction documents, fund or JV governance arrangements, and deal structuring.
  • A strong technical foundation with excellent drafting, analytical and negotiation skills.
  • Experience leading/mentoring teams is desirable.
